Leaves and Time Off: Canada provides various types of leaves to protect workers during critical life events. Maternity and parental leave, compassionate care leave, and sick leave are examples of provisions designed to support employees in times of need.

Part-Time Employment Contracts: Part-time employment contracts are designed for individuals who work fewer hours than those specified in a standard full-time position. These contracts outline the agreed-upon working hours, salary, and benefits on a proportional basis compared to full-time employees.
